Latest Patents

One of her latest patents is titled "Method and apparatus for performance efficient ISA virtualization using dynamic partial binary translation." This invention discloses methods, apparatus, and systems for the virtualization of a native instruction set. The embodiment includes a processor core that executes native instructions alongside a second core that consumes less power while executing a second instruction set. This second core's decoder is designed to detect invalid opcodes, while a microcode layer disassembler determines whether these opcodes should be translated. The translation runtime environment identifies executable regions containing invalid opcodes and generates a partial translation that includes encapsulations of the translations of invalid opcodes and state recoveries of the machine states, which are then saved to a translation cache memory.
